The MBTA Half-Time Bus Operator is responsible for safely operating MBTA buses along designated routes, providing reliable and efficient transportation services to passengers. The operator performs routine vehicle inspections to ensure proper operation; collects fares from passengers; and assists in emergency situations. This position works under occasional supervision, following MBTA guidelines and procedures. This position requires completion of a full-time (weekday) intensive training program, after which the operator's work shifts will be limited to weekday mornings.
Training Requirements:
- Completion of a comprehensive 10–12 week, full-time training program, covering all aspects of bus operation, safety procedures, customer service, and MBTA policies and regulations.
- Successful attainment of a commercial driver's license (CDL) with passenger & air brakes endorsements.
- Ability to pass a pre-employment drug screening and background check.
Schedule: Once fully trained, the MBTA Half-Time Bus Operator will work a maximum of 20 hours per week, primarily during weekday mornings (from start of business until 12:00pm). Location: This position will report to Cabot Bus Garage, 275 Dorchester Ave, Boston, MA 02127, once training is completed. PLEASE NOTE: Half-Time Operators may elect to transfer in to the Full-Time Operator classification after working as a Half-Time Operator for a minimum of four (4) full ratings, following their completion of training.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Safely operate surface line vehicle in adherence to established routes and schedules. Operation of the surface line vehicle includes picking up passengers, collecting fares, checking passes and ID cards for validity, protecting revenue collected according to defined procedures, sitting for extended periods of time, and some exposure to vibrations, noise, airborne particles and fumes.
- Inspect and/or test the vehicle (including, but not limited to, brakes, lights, signs, doors, mirrors, wipers, tires and horn) to ensure serviceable condition. Regularly climb onto side of bus and reach with hands and arms to adjust side view mirrors.
- Report and identify mechanical problems or defects to the appropriate authority.
- Operate surface line vehicle maintaining appropriate speed and following distance from vehicles.
- Ensure that proper signs are displayed and changed as needed during each trip. Clearly announce destination at service stops, connecting points, and at all intervals along a route sufficient to permit individuals to orient themselves to their location.
- Notify the Bus Control Center Dispatcher of any emergency, requesting additional assistance if needed.
- Evacuate passengers if the emergency situation warrants action and the Inspector is not available to make the decision. Operate onboard fire extinguisher.
- Maintain adequate knowledge of the MBTA system in order to provide routine information and directions to the public.
- Refer disputes over ID validity or fare collection to the official in charge of the station. Produce a written report to the Superintendent if the dispute is not resolved.
- Prepare accident reports as required.
- Respond to each inquiry, whether from a customer, vendor or co-worker, in a courteous and professional manner consistent with the Authority's "Driven by Customer Service" quality standard.
- Report for duty on time and remain on duty for the duration of a scheduled work shift.
- Report to work during declared states of emergency as essential personnel.
- Uphold the rights and interests of the Authority while building and maintaining an effective relationship with employees.
- Assist in the management of a workforce by ensuring the fair and consistent application and strict adherence to the rules, regulations, collective bargaining agreements (if applicable) and policies of the Authority including the EEO, Anti-Discrimination and Anti-Harassment and Anti Retaliation policies.
- Perform related duties as assigned.

*NOTE: Anyone hired in this position is required to successfully complete a required probationary period of 120 working days. Continued employment is also subject to obtaining a Class B Massachusetts CDL Permit (with Knowledge, Air Brakes, and Passenger endorsements) and later obtaining a CDL. Individuals who are hired without the requisite CDL Permit will be provided training, for up to two weeks, and must pass the CDL Permit test within this two-week training period to continue their employment. There will be a maximum of two attempts in these two weeks to satisfy this requirement.
